Nematodes, specifically Caenorhabditis elegans (C. elegans), serve as a valuable model system for studying Motor Neuron Disease (MND). The primary cause of MND in nematode models is the mutation of certain genes that are homologous to those associated with MND in humans. By studying nematodes, scientists can gain insights into the mechanisms and processes involved in MND, including cellular interactions, cell fate determinations, and intracellular transport.
